I re-tested calls to VM replacing some of FS prompts with * ones, and it

appears that * sounds were recorded with a better quality/higher volume,

so FS itself has nothing to do with that. That's solved. :-)
I am going to double check all  the equipment we used for tests, like 
headphones, telephone sets, cables since I am almost convinced that 
there's nothing in FS which can produce effects I observe.
